How financial institutions deal with problem loans Problem loans are a natural outcome of the risks banks and credit unions take when lending, and they should be expected over the long run during the ups and downs of the business cycle. The Concepts Lending Curve: A yield curve shows interest rates associated with different contract lengths for a particular interest rate instrument. While economists may use the shape of the yield curve to gauge future economic strength, bankers should pay particular attention to the lending curve.
